细菌降解硝基苯的研究
Study on the degradiation of nitrobenzene by a bacterium and its optimal condition
【摘要】 通过驯化、选择性培养,从制药厂曝气池活性污泥中分离出一株能降解硝基苯的细菌,经鉴定为短杆菌属(brevibacterium)。该菌对硝基苯具有较高的忍耐能力,在含硝基苯5000μg/g的固体培养基上生长良好,其最适降解条件为充分曝气供氧,温度30℃,pH8.0,在此条件下含硝基苯200μg/g的液体培养基中摇床培养24h,硝基苯最高降解率为50.l%。
